The District-First Trojan Horse

BloomBoard's genius is selling to districts, not teachers. While competitors chase individual educators, they lock in administrative budgets. The CEO Sanford Kenyon and President Jason Lange built a B2B2C model where districts pay for pipeline, advancement, and retention—solutions that actually matter to superintendents. This isn't a tool; it's infrastructure.

The Retention Crisis Playbook

Teacher turnover costs districts $20K per exit. BloomBoard's model flips the script: instead of recruiting endlessly, they build internal pipelines. Their three-pronged attack—educator pipeline, advancement, retention—attacks the root cause. With $21.1M in revenue, they're proving districts will pay to stop the bleeding.
